Found him on the passenger list of the S.S. Friedrich Der Grosse as
Wilhelm Finger age 22, single, sailing from Bremen, Germany September 9, 1905 and arriving in New York September 19, 1905. Passage was paid for by himself, he has $60 in his posession, and he is going to join his friend
Gerhard Gayken in Lemon, S.D. His residence before leaving Germany was Bremerhaven.
Found him on the 1910 Lamro, Tripp, South Dakota census (dist 109 img 6) as
William Finger age 26, druggist.

Found him on the 1920 Brighton, Sacramento, California census as
William John Henry Finger age 36, manager, poultry farm. His mother-in-law
Emma Niesen is living with his family. Also 3 boarders.
Found him on the 1930 Sacramento, Sacramento, California census (dist 61 img 27) as
William J. H. Finger age 46, proprietor, cleaning & dyeing.
